### Step 4: Point traffic at the user service

After the Harrowgate user module is extracted, update the router so profile and session calls hit the new service, not the monolith. Verify health checks pass for two minutes before flipping writes. Leave reads dual-served until step 6. Apply the configuration values shown below to the new service.

deployment values, yadup-kadug:
[sorys]
port = 5672
team = noveth
host = sorys.orvexcorp.example
region = south-4
access_code = ac_deddc1
timeout_ms = 1500

# Fan-out Backpressure: Limits and Quotas

The Heraldry notification service fans out one publish event to many subscriber queues. Backpressure kicks in when downstream consumers lag: the dispatcher shrinks batch sizes and eventually sheds low-priority notifications. These limits were set after the Quillton launch overload and have held steady since. Maintainers should treat them as a coupled set — raising the queue depth without raising the shed threshold just delays the stall. The effective constants are defined below.

tuning constants:
WEIGHTS = {
    "wendor": 631,
    "norir": 625,
    "julael": 998,
}

Subject: Second-source supplier update

Team — quick note before Friday's exec sync. The search for a second source on the Kelsor valve assemblies is down to two candidates: Brintham Precision and Orvale Components. Dana's team finished site visits last week and both passed. Pricing gap is under 4%. Decision target is end of month. The confidential planning note follows below.

confidential, tajeg-hawif: Only 5 of the 80 pilot accounts renewed Quenwyn, so a churn review is set for April 1.

### Runbook: Pellworth Office Move — Records Crates

Okay folks, the move to Cranmere Court is happening over the weekend. All records crates get sealed Friday by 4pm, labelled by shelf range, and stacked by the loading bay. Nothing leaves without a manifest tick from the records lead. The courier firm, Bellhop Logistics, collects Saturday at 8am sharp. Their hand-over instruction is below.

handover note for yagef-bagep: the drudor pelius courier leaves the kasdor zorvan norir ledger at gate 8016 under passcode 755406